Vocals / Guitar / Harmonica
My first live gig was in 1969 at Steele Jr. High Schools 9th grade dance. My band mates and I borrowed as many amplifiers as we could in an effort to look like Cream. Only 2 amps were plugged in, but man we looked good!
The early 70s I dont remember (I was there), but in 1976 I teamed up with Alan Goodman to produce and perform in a concert at the Howmet Theater in Whitehall, Michigan. In the show we covered songs by Jim Croce, Dan Fogelburg, and the Beatles. Around 1985 Bob Malenfont (a childhood friend) and I started another 2 piece acoustic act known as Hatfield & McCoy playing local venues like the V.I.P. and the Red Rooster. I also played a number of charity shows for the March of Dimes as a solo act.
In 1986 I met Jimi Ray. We were both selling vacuum cleaners. When I learned that he was a bass player I knew this would be a friendship made in music heaven. The two of us co-founded a blues band that we called the Blues Persuasion. During the following years Jimi Ray and I recorded many different styles of music including blues, rock, country, and folk. Jimi and I have been performing and recording for almost 20 years. Also during that time Dale Durda and I played the first Steak and Blues show at the Muskegon Recreation Club.
In the late 80s I co-founded a rock cover band with Tom Shaub named i.e. Also from that time to the present I polished my chops jammin with Jeff Olsen and Out of Control, Tight Fit, and R-Eazy, while continuing to record. In '93 Jimi Ray and I co-founded another blues band that we dubbed "BootLeg".
In 2002 I played with M.M.G., a blues and blues rock band. M.M.G. performed at many parties, a show at Heritage Landing, and the regional stage for The Muskegon Summer Celebration in 2003.
Also in 2003, Jimi Ray and I built our own private 24 and 64-track recording studio/video editing suite - Vinyl Wall Productions.
The Big House Blues Band is what I have been working towards my whole life. Not only have Jimi Ray and I finally found the right musicians, but Im in a blues band with my son and my best friend.
